Bobcat T630 vs John Deere T332: Which Is the Better Value?
The Bobcat T630 averages $34,135 CAD at auction, compared to $26,777 for the John Deere T332. That's a $7,357 difference. Based on 62 verified Canadian auction results tracked by TrackCheck, here's the full breakdown.
The Verdict
The John Deere T332 is the better value buy for most Canadian buyers, averaging $7,357 less than the T630.

What are the key differences between T630 and T332?
- Price: The T332 is $7,357 cheaper on average (22% savings).
- Track Type: T630 is a compact track loader (CTL) while T332 is a wheeled skid steer (SSL). CTLs have better traction on soft ground; wheeled units are faster and cheaper to maintain.

How do T630 and T332 prices compare by year?
| Year | Bobcat T630 | John Deere T332 |
|---|---|---|
| 2017 | $25,078 (4) | — |
| 2016 | $40,963 (8) | — |
| 2015 | $39,780 (6) | — |
| 2014 | $31,408 (4) | — |
| 2013 | $49,051 (2) | — |
| 2012 | $25,447 (6) | — |
| 2011 | $17,992 (2) | — |
| 2010 | $40,745 (2) | — |
| 2009 | — | $33,865 (4) |
| 2008 | — | $32,168 (10) |
| 2007 | — | $25,043 (8) |
| 2006 | — | $15,379 (6) |
Prices in CAD. Numbers in parentheses are sample size. Lower price highlighted.
How do T630 and T332 prices compare by hours?
| Hours | Bobcat T630 | John Deere T332 |
|---|---|---|
| 0-999 hrs | $54,977 (2) | $20,400 (4) |
| 1,000-1,999 hrs | $42,278 (8) | — |
| 2,000-2,999 hrs | $37,143 (8) | $33,015 (6) |
| 3,000-3,999 hrs | $29,472 (8) | $33,498 (10) |
| 4,000+ hrs | $22,436 (8) | $21,394 (6) |
